Title: Nobuhiko Ozaki: A Pioneer in Pharmacologic Measurement Innovations
Introduction
Nobuhiko Ozaki is an esteemed inventor hailing from Nara, Japan. With a remarkable portfolio of 19 patents, he has made significant contributions to the field of pharmacologic measurement. His innovative approach to detecting biological reactions has paved the way for advancements in medical technology.
Latest Patents
Nobuhiko Ozaki's recent work includes groundbreaking inventions such as the "Instrument and system for pharmacologic measurement." This instrument is designed to detect minute and rapid changes in electric signals that occur due to pharmacologic actions in biological specimens. It excels at minimizing external disturbances while conducting medicinal solution exchanges. The device includes a well vessel with measurement electrodes and reference electrodes that work together to provide high precision in measurements.
Another noteworthy invention is the "Substrate including channel part having chamber, and multistage liquid feed device comprising the same." This innovative substrate allows for the stepwise feeding of liquids through a channel part, which is controlled by the rotational speed of the substrate. The design cleverly utilizes varying chamber dimensions to optimize the centrifugal force applied to the solutions, enhancing the efficiency of liquid handling.
